General Info
In Block
65fa2232a35cabb4420ff9838591a034280b083747415377826844a4a93dcc5f
In block height
Total Input
177052.55548959 RDD
Total Output
177410.46531547 RDD
Transaction Details
Fee
0 RDD
mined Mon, 18 Oct 2021 03:11:07 UTC
From
177052.55548959 RDD